# Claimsmiths Law
Claimsmiths Law is a Manchester-based legal practice specialising in consumer rights and dispute resolution. Led by partners Adam Morallee, Michael Forrester (Head of Litigation), and Tom Giles (Head of Legal), the firm combines decades of collective legal experience to tackle cases where other firms have failed.
The firm primarily serves consumers who have experienced injustice through housing disrepair claims, personal data theft, and broader consumer protection matters. They position themselves as problem-solvers, explicitly stating they "get results where others cannot" and provide expert guidance in complex or challenging circumstances.
What distinguishes Claimsmiths is their willingness to take on difficult cases and their track record of success in areas where other legal practitioners have struggled. Rather than offering generic legal services, they focus on vulnerable consumers and those seeking justice in specific, high-impact areas. Their emphasis on "standing up for the rights of consumers" suggests a client-focused approach centred on advocacy rather than purely transactional work.
The firm maintains SRA accreditation and operates from a prominent Manchester city centre location on Princess Street. They actively recruit talent, indicating growth and ongoing investment in their team. Their website emphasises expertise and results-driven outcomes, appealing to clients seeking reliable counsel and proven advocacy rather than high-street convenience.
